Industry Outlook

The Turkey Mobile Robot Market was valued at USD 379.18 million in 2025 and is estimated to reach USD 466.42 million in 2026. The market is projected to expand steadily over the forecast period, reaching USD 1,364.83 million by 2035, registering a CAGR of 12.67% from 2026 to 2035. In terms of volume, the market recorded 8 thousand units in 2025 and is expected to reach 10 thousand units in 2026, further rising to 35 thousand units by 2035, reflecting a CAGR of 14.45% during the same period.

Growth Drivers

How Is Turkey's Position as a Manufacturing and Logistics Bridge Driving the Mobile Robot Market?

Our market assessment indicates that Turkey's position as a strategic manufacturing and logistics bridge along the Middle Corridor trade route connecting Europe, Asia, and the Middle East, combined with its strong automotive manufacturing base centered in Bursa, is a unique factor accelerating demand for mobile robots. Automotive OEMs and component suppliers are deploying automated guided vehicles and autonomous mobile robots to support production logistics, while Turkey's cross-continental trade position is encouraging distribution centers to modernize material handling operations.

How Is E-Commerce Growth Driving Mobile Robot Adoption Across Turkey?

Based on our market evaluation, the rapid growth of e-commerce platforms and omnichannel retail across Turkey is driving increased deployment of mobile robots within fulfillment and distribution centers. Retailers and third-party logistics providers are investing in autonomous mobile robots and automated guided vehicles to manage rising parcel volumes, shorten delivery timelines, and improve picking accuracy. This growth is encouraging warehouse operators nationwide to modernize intralogistics operations through scalable robotic automation solutions.

How Is the Textile Export Industry Accelerating Automation Investment in Turkey?

According to NMSC research, Turkey's large textile and apparel export industry is driving demand for automated material handling and distribution logistics to support high-volume production and shipping schedules. Manufacturers and logistics providers serving global fashion brands are investing in mobile robots to manage inventory movement, order fulfillment, and warehouse operations efficiently. This export-driven demand is helping Turkish textile companies maintain competitiveness while meeting stringent international delivery timelines.

Growth Inhibitor

What Factors Are Restraining Growth in the Turkey Mobile Robot Market?

Despite strong growth prospects, high upfront capital investment combined with currency volatility affecting the cost of imported robotics equipment continues to restrain broader market expansion. Through our market analysis, we observed that many smaller manufacturers and logistics providers face budget constraints amid fluctuating import costs, delaying automation adoption. Additionally, integrating mobile robots with legacy production systems and ensuring interoperability across diverse robotic platforms increases implementation timelines and overall project costs.

Growth Opportunity

How Is Expansion into Food, Beverage, and Pharmaceutical Logistics Creating New Growth Opportunities?

Through NMSC's assessment, we found that the adoption of mobile robots is expanding rapidly beyond automotive and textile manufacturing into food and beverage, pharmaceuticals, and e-commerce fulfillment sectors, supported by Turkey's growing domestic manufacturing base and national technology initiatives. Food processors and pharmaceutical distributors are increasingly investing in autonomous mobile robots for material transport and warehouse handling. As navigation technologies continue advancing, these emerging applications are expected to generate substantial long-term growth opportunities across Turkey.

How Is the Turkey Mobile Robot Market Segmented, and What Are the Key Insights from the Segmentation Analysis?

By Payload Capacity Insights

How Is Payload Capacity Influencing Mobile Robot Adoption Across the Turkey Mobile Robot Market?

Based on payload capacity, the market is segmented into Up to 100 kg, 101–500 kg, 501–1,000 kg, 1,001–2,000 kg, and Above 2,000 kg. Each capacity tier corresponds to distinct operational use cases, ranging from light-duty component and tote transport to heavy-duty pallet, forklift, and industrial load handling, allowing manufacturers, warehouses, and distribution centers across Turkey to select mobile robot solutions aligned with their specific throughput and material handling requirements.

Based on our evaluation, payload capacity remains a key factor shaping deployment strategies across end-user industries in Turkey. Robots with capacities up to 100 kg are widely used for light-duty tasks such as component transport and textile handling, while the 101–500 kg and 501–1,000 kg segments dominate warehousing and general manufacturing applications. Robots exceeding 1,001 kg are gaining traction in automotive manufacturing, where high-load transportation and continuous material handling remain essential to production efficiency.

By Technology Insights

Is Technology Segmentation Driving Innovation Across the Turkey Mobile Robot Market?

Based on technology, the market is segmented into Automated Guided Vehicles, Autonomous Mobile Robots, and Hybrid Mobile Robots. AGVs are further classified into Magnetic Guidance, Wire Guidance, Optical Guidance, QR Code Guidance, and Laser Guidance, while AMRs are segmented into LiDAR Navigation, Vision Navigation, SLAM Navigation, Natural Feature Navigation, and AI-Based Navigation. Hybrid Mobile Robots are categorized into Mixed Guidance Systems and Switchable Navigation Systems.

Based on our analysis, Autonomous Mobile Robots are witnessing the fastest adoption across Turkish warehouses and manufacturing facilities owing to their intelligent navigation, flexibility, and ability to operate safely alongside human workers in dynamic environments. Automated Guided Vehicles remain widely used for repetitive, high-volume material handling in structured automotive and textile production facilities due to their reliability and cost efficiency. Hybrid Mobile Robots are gaining traction by combining multiple navigation technologies, supporting increasingly versatile robotic deployments across the country.
